Frequently Asked Questions

What are the deadlines for filing property tax appeals in Cook County?
Assessment appeals must typically be filed within 30 days of receiving your assessment notice. The firm monitors these deadlines carefully and will ensure all filings are completed on time.
How much can I expect to save on my property taxes?
Savings vary significantly based on your property's over-assessment level. Successful residential appeals often achieve 10-25% reductions, while commercial appeals can sometimes achieve larger savings.
Do you guarantee results for property tax appeals?
No attorney can guarantee specific outcomes in tax appeals. However, the firm provides honest assessments of your case's potential and only takes cases they believe have reasonable chances of success.
What information do I need to bring for the initial consultation?
Bring recent property tax bills, assessment notices, and any documentation about your property's condition or recent sales of comparable properties. The firm will guide you on additional materials needed.
How long does the appeal process typically take?
Most residential appeals resolve within 6-12 months, while commercial cases can take 8-18 months. Complex cases involving multiple appeal levels may take longer.
